Minerve to Verdon Gorge

The Verdon Gorge is a stunning natural wonder located in the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ur region of southeastern France. It is the largest canyon in Europe, and its turquoise waters and towering cliffs make it a popular destination for tourists and outdoor enthusiasts alike.
